Refrigerant R-134A is classified as a hydrofluorocarbon (HFC). It is widely used in air conditioning and refrigeration systems as a replacement for ozone-depleting substances like R-12. R-134A has a low ozone depletion potential (ODP) and is considered a more environmentally friendly option compared to older refrigerants. However, it still has a global warming potential (GWP) that has led to discussions about its eventual phase-out in favor of more sustainable alternatives.
